Any Info/leads On Suspension Springs +10% +20% ?

Featured Replies

Hello,

I have a 2005 Sherco 2.9.

I'm looking for some heavier springs similar to what is available for GasGas.

If you know of anyone that can supply, or produce, these springs please let me know.

Thanks in Advance

The problem I'm having is that Splat says only 2006 and up have access to +10% +20% springs.

I'm going to decode the VIN number to verify what year I have.

I believe its a 2005 so that just misses it.

What colour is the frame, if chrome it's definitely 05 or earlier. Forks changed to having damping adjustment & a cartridge insert in 1 side instead of the simple forks run from 01-05

  • Author

It seems that '05 and below you cant get +10% +20% springs.

I'm wondering if it might be work it to swap the forks for the newer ones, '06 and up.

I'm going to look around for a set but it will probably cost too much.

Lookup a local spring winder and have them make new springs for you, it'll be far cheaper than replacing the forks and then fitting uprated springs.
